Guests at the Tollbridge site get online via the guest Wi-Fi desk, just left of the big fern at reception. Have them sign the visitor sheet first — no sheet, no network, sorry. The desk tablet walks them through the terms, takes about a minute. If the tablet's flat (happens weekly), the Orvane staffer on duty can open the equipment drawer, which unlocks with the pass below.

turnstile pass: bdg-JVSWH-52711

Handover Note — Keldora Line Retirement

Hi all — as I pass the Keldora product line to Marit before my move to the Ostvale office, a quick rundown for branch managers. Last production run ships end of month; spares inventory covers 18 months of service commitments. Please stop quoting Keldora on new deals now and steer customers to the Fenwick range. Trade-in credits are pre-approved up to tier two. Marit will circulate the migration playbook next week. One more thing you should see before the branch calls.

internal memo for kagap-hahig: Project Aldeth slips by six weeks because of the staffing delay.

## Local Setup

Hey support folks! If you need to run FlagPilot locally to reproduce a rollout issue, it's pretty painless. Install the deps with `./scripts/bootstrap`, then start the dashboard with `make dev`. Flag definitions and rollout percentages live in a shared staging database, so you'll see the same flags customers reference in tickets — no seeding required. One heads-up: the dashboard is read-write, so don't toggle anything you didn't create. Point your local config at staging using the connection string below.

primary connection of yagep-kahip = redis://giliel_svc:zYiKsLL2PLpfPL@db-348f.xolmarsys.corp:5432/fenwyn